On 06/11/17 17:26, Sinan Kaya wrote:
quoted hunk ↗ jump to hunk
Add support for probing the newer HW.

Signed-off-by: Sinan Kaya <redacted>
---
 drivers/dma/qcom/hidma.c | 6 ++++++
 1 file changed, 6 insertions(+)
diff --git a/drivers/dma/qcom/hidma.c b/drivers/dma/qcom/hidma.c
index e366985..29d6aaa 100644
--- a/drivers/dma/qcom/hidma.c
+++ b/drivers/dma/qcom/hidma.c
@@ -749,9 +749,13 @@ static bool hidma_msi_capable(struct device *dev)
 			return false;
 
 		ret = strcmp(of_compat, "qcom,hidma-1.1");
+		if (ret)
+			ret = strcmp(of_compat, "qcom,hidma-1.2");
 	} else {
 #ifdef CONFIG_ACPI
 		ret = strcmp(acpi_device_hid(adev), "QCOM8062");
+		if (ret)
+			ret = strcmp(acpi_device_hid(adev), "QCOM8063");
This string-juggling looks to have already hit the point at which it
doesn't scale well - it would be a lot nicer to make use of
of_device_get_match_data() and the ACPI equivalent to abstract the
version-specific data appropriately.

Robin.
